The Quality Assurance Nurse oversees the clinical operations of the Quality Assurance Program to ensure compliance with NCCHC standards, policies, and applicable laws. This role leads quality improvement initiatives by establishing committees, preparing reports, and evaluating clinical performance data. The QA Nurse collaborates with facility leadership and mental health providers to develop process improvements, corrective actions, and outcome studies. They ensure physician chart reviews, facilitate accreditation readiness, and support suicide prevention strategies. The position operates independently, often in correctional facilities, and may involve travel.
Lead the CQI committee, coordinate quarterly meetings, and prepare audit and internal quality reports
Oversee data collection and analysis for QA initiatives including intake, pharmacy, mental health, and emergency care
Develop and evaluate corrective action plans in collaboration with the Health Services Administrator
Support NCCHC accreditation through ongoing maintenance of compliance documentation
Collaborate with Mental Health to address suicide prevention and conduct morbidity/mortality reviews
